@charset "utf-8";
/* CSS Document */
html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,b, u, i, center,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td,p { margin: 0; padding: 0; border: 0; outline: 0; font-size: 100%; vertical-align: baseline; background:transparent;}
/*li {list-style: none;}*/
body{ font-family:"微软雅黑";font-size: 14px; font-weight:normal;}
a {text-decoration: none; }
li {list-style: none;}
.clear{ clear:both}
.fleft{ float:left;}
.fright{ float:right;}
.w980{ width:980px; margin:0 auto;}
.txt_link{height:30px;line-height:30px;font-size:12px;color:#333; text-align:right}
.txt_link a{font-size:12px;color:#333;}

.banner{ background:url(zxxszhjx2017_banner.jpg) no-repeat top center; width:100%;height:258px;}
.banner_title{width:940px; padding:20px;font-size:16px;}
.banner_ewm{width:89px; margin-right:20px;}
.banner_ewm img{padding-bottom:10px;}
.nav{width:100%; background-color:#eeeeee;border-top:1px #e5e5e5 solid;border-bottom:1px #e5e5e5 solid;height:40px; margin-bottom:30px;}
.nav_title{height:40px; width:860px; margin:auto;}
.nav_title_a{width:120px;height:20px;line-height:20px;font-size:16px; margin:10px auto;border-right:1px #333 solid; text-align:center;color:#333;}
.nav_title_b{width:120px;height:20px;line-height:20px;font-size:16px; margin:10px auto;border-right:1px #333 solid; text-align:center;color:#0a8240; font-weight:bold;}
.nav_title_a a{color:#333;font-size:16px}

.main{width:660px; margin-right:20px}
.main_cont{ margin-bottom:30px;}
.main_title_980{ background:url(zxxszhjx2017_titlebj02.jpg) no-repeat left;width:965px;height:28px;line-height:28px;color:#fff;padding-left:15px;font-size:16px;font-weight:bold;margin-bottom:10px;}
.main_title_660{ background:url(zxxszhjx2017_titlebj02.jpg) no-repeat left;width:645px;height:28px;line-height:28px;color:#fff;padding-left:15px;font-size:16px;font-weight:bold;margin-bottom:10px;}
.main_title_660b{ background:url(zxxszhjx2017_titlebj02.jpg) no-repeat left;width:645px;height:28px;line-height:28px;color:#fff;padding-left:15px;font-size:16px;font-weight:bold;}
.main_title_800{ background:url(zxxszhjx2017_titlebj02.jpg) no-repeat left;width:785px;height:28px;line-height:28px;color:#fff;padding-left:15px;font-size:16px;font-weight:bold;margin-bottom:10px;}
.main_bqjd_book{width:140px;height:190px; background-color:#CCC;margin-right:20px;}
.main_bqjd_title{width:500px;height:40px;line-height:40px;font-size:16px;font-weight:bold;color:#333;}
.main_bqjd_title a{font-size:16px;font-weight:bold;color:#333;}
.main_bqjd_titleb{ background:url(zxxszhjx2017_b-b.gif) no-repeat left center;width:490px;height:30px;line-height:30px;font-size:14px;color:#333; padding-left:10px;}
.main_bqjd_titleb a{font-size:14px;color:#333;}
.main_bqjd_titlec{width:450px;height:40px;line-height:40px;font-size:16px;font-weight:bold;color:#333;}
.main_bqjd_titlec a{font-size:16px;font-weight:bold;color:#333;}
.main_title_380{background:url(zxxszhjx2017_titlebj02.jpg) no-repeat left;width:365px;height:28px;line-height:28px;color:#fff;padding-left:15px;font-size:16px;font-weight:bold;margin-bottom:10px;}
.main_jyzx_text{width:380px; margin-right:20px;}
.main_jyzx_titleb{ background:url(zxxszhjx2017_b-b.gif) no-repeat left center;width:370px;height:30px;line-height:30px;font-size:14px;color:#333; padding-left:10px;}
.main_jyzx_titleb a{font-size:14px;color:#333;}
.main_jyzx_pic{width:260px;height:180px; background-color:#CCC;}
#slider img{ width:260px;height:180px;}
.main_border{width:638px;border:1px #e5e5e5 solid;padding:10px;}
.main_msyl_pic{width:100px; margin-right:20px; background-color:#CCC;}
.main_msyl_con{width:510px;}
.main_szkt_con{width:450px;}
.main_msyl_text{font-size:14px;color:#333;line-height:1.75em;}
.main_msyl_text a{font-size:14px;color:#333;}
.main_szkt_pic{width:160px; margin-left:20px; background-color:#CCC;}


.side{width:300px;}
.bkgg{margin-bottom:20px;}
.side_lm{ background:url(zxxszhjx2017_titlebj01.jpg) no-repeat;height:30px;line-height:30px;width:300px;color:#fff;font-size:16px; font-weight:bold; text-align:center;}


.bkgg_bj{ background:url(zxxszhjx2017_sidebarbj.jpg) repeat-y;width:294px; border-left:1px #e5e5e5 solid;border-bottom:3px #e5e5e5 solid;border-right:4px #e5e5e5 solid;}
.bkgg_title{margin-left:25px;width:260px;height:39px;line-height:39px;color:#333;}
.bkgg_title a{color:#333;}
.tgyx{width:270px;height:80px; background-color:#f4f4f4;margin-bottom:20px;padding:15px 0 15px 30px;}
.tgyx_txt{margin:30px 0 0 30px;width:150px;height:40px;font-size:18px; font-weight:bold;color:#666; }
.tgyx_txt a{font-size:18px; font-weight:bold;color:#666; }
.tgyx_txtb{margin:20px 0 0 0;width:150px;height:40px;font-size:16px; font-weight:bold;color:#666; text-align:center}
.hzhb{width:260px;padding:20px;background-color:#f4f4f4;}
.hzhb_border{width:260px;padding:20px 0; border-bottom:1px #fff solid;}
.hzhb_borderb{width:260px;padding:20px 0;}

.main_tl{ margin-bottom:30px}
.main_tl_piccon{width:940px;margin:20px; height:169px; overflow:hidden;}
.main_tl_picborder{width:96px;height:163px;margin-right:17px;border:1px #eee solid;padding:2px;position:relative;}
.main_tl_picborderb{width:96px;height:163px;border:1px #eee solid;padding:2px;position:relative;}
.main_tl_pictext{ background:url(zxxszhjx2017_photobj.png) no-repeat;padding:12px 0 0 6px;width:90px;height:63px; position:relative; top:-13px;left:-1px; z-index:9;}
.main_tl_pictitle{font-size:14px;color:#666;margin-bottom:5px;}
.main_tl_pictitle a{font-size:14px;color:#666;}
.font12{ font-size:12px;color:#666;}
.main_tl_down{width:940px;height:24px;background:url(zxxszhjx2017_open.png) no-repeat center center #ccc; margin:10px auto;}
.main_tl_up{width:940px;height:24px;background:url(zxxszhjx2017_close.png) no-repeat center center #ccc; margin:10px auto;}
.footer{ background-color:#0a8240; width:100%;height:30px;line-height:30px;color:#fff;font-size:14px;}
.footer a{color:#fff;font-size:14px;}
/*以上首页和公用代码*/

.cj{height:40px;line-height:40px;color:#666;font-size:14px;}
.cj a{font-size:14px;color:#666;}
.bkjs{margin-top:30px;line-height:2em;color:#666;font-size:16px;}
.bkln{ background-color:#eee;font-size:14px; padding:10px;line-height:1.75em;color:#333;}
.bkln a{font-size:14px; color:#333;}
.bkln_b{ font-weight:bold;font-size:14px; color:#333;}
.bkln_text{ text-indent:2em;line-height:1.75em;font-size:14px; color:#333;}
.bkln_text a{font-size:14px; color:#333;}
.per50{width:46%;margin:0 10px 10px 0;}
.per20{width:18%;margin:0 10px 10px 0;}

.zjwyh_title{ background:url(zxxszhjx2017_1px.gif) repeat-x center;width:100%;height:40px;}
.zjwyh_title_font{ background-color:#FFF; padding-right:10px;height:40px;line-height:40px;}
.zj_pic{width:96px;height:96px;border-radius:50%; background-color:#CCC}
.zj_pic img{border-radius:50%;}
.zj_title{ margin-top:10px;width:96px;line-height:2em;color:#666; text-align:center}
.zj_title a{ color:#666; font-size:14px;}
.zj_title_font{width:96px;line-height:1.5em;color:#666;font-size:12px;text-align:center}
.ckjy_txt{width:190px;height:60px;padding:5px; background-color:#060;color:#fff;font-size:14px;}
.ckjy_txt a{color:#fff;font-size:14px;}
.per33{width:200px;margin:0 0 20px 13px; border:1px #006600 solid;}

.per33 img{ margin:0; border:none;}
.lb_title{height:40px;line-height:40px;width:650px;padding-left:10px;border-bottom:2px #fff solid; background-color:#eee;color:#333;font-size:14px;}
.lb_title a{color:#333;font-size:14px;}
.wz_title{ width:100%;line-height:3em;font-size:16px; font-weight:bold;color:#333; text-align:center;}
.wz_titleb{ width:100%;line-height:3em;font-size:14px;color:#333; text-align:center;}
.wz_people{ width:100%;line-height:3em;font-size:12px;color:#333; text-align:center;}
.wz_text{ text-align:left;line-height:2em; text-indent:2em;color:#333;}
.p10{padding:10px;}
.qk_sidbar{ width:140px; padding:10px 10px 20px 10px; background-color:#eee; margin-right:20px;}
.qk_dqtitle{ margin:10px 0;width:140px; text-align:center;color:#060;font-size:14px;}
.qk_dqtitle a{color:#060;font-size:14px;}
.qk_dqtitle02{width:140px; text-align:center;color:#666;font-size:12px;line-height:2em;}
.qk_dqtitle02 a{color:#666;font-size:12px;}
.w800{width:800px; margin-bottom:20px;}
.qk_title{ color:#666;font-size:14px;line-height:2.5em;}
.qk_title a{ color:#666;font-size:14px;}
.qk_title_700{width:650px; margin-left:10px;}
.qk_title_100{width:120px; text-align:right; margin-right:10px;}
.fx{width:400px; margin:30px 0 20px 0;}